New Door Installation
A full new door installation in Montclair typically falls between $700 and $2,200, depending on size, insulation rating, and whether structural framing work is required underneath. Many 1960s-70s homes in Montclair have original headers that were framed too low for modern torsion-spring systems, which means the labor goes beyond just swapping panels. We measure the opening, the header depth, the side room, and the backroom before quoting anything, because those numbers determine what can actually be hung safely. When we install a new door, the price includes haul-away of the old one, new track, new springs, and new seals unless otherwise noted in writing.

Double Car Door
Double car doors are where Montclair’s older housing stock creates the most surprises. Homes built in the 1960s and 70s were framed for narrow single-wide doors, so converting to a double car door often means cutting the opening wider and reinforcing the header with new LVL beams. A double door installation runs $1,200-$2,200 depending on width, insulation, and framing scope. We quote the framing work explicitly, because skipping it is how you end up with a torsion spring mount that rips out of the wall inside a year. The heavier the door, the more the structure underneath matters.

Common Garage Door Installation Problems We See in Montclair Homes

- Undersized headers on 1960s-80s tract homes. The original header was framed low and shallow because the original door was light and narrow. Mounting a modern insulated double door on that header without reinforcement is how you get a spring mount that tears out under repeated heat cycling. We check header depth and bearing plate clearance on every Montclair install, and we quote framing reinforcement as a separate line item so you know what’s structural and what’s cosmetic.
- Torsion spring fatigue from Inland Empire heat. Montclair sits deep in the valley where summer temperatures routinely pass 100°F. Thermal expansion and contraction works springs like a fatigue machine. Standard 10,000-cycle springs on a daily-use door fail in 4-5 years here, faster than in Claremont or Upland where the microclimate is slightly milder. We default to high-cycle springs on every Montclair install and show you the cycle rating in writing before you approve the job.
- Santa Ana wind damage to track and panels. The passes funnel wind through Montclair in the fall, and older track brackets that held lightweight 1960s panels don’t hold up under heavier modern doors when the gusts hit. We torque-check every bracket and replace corroded fasteners as part of installation. It’s not an add-on. It’s part of hanging a door that stays on its track.
- Weather seal degradation from UV exposure. The same heat that fatigues springs also bakes rubber bottom seals until they crack and split. On homes along Mills Avenue and the other main corridors, we replace bottom seals during installation as standard practice. Montclair’s summer heat is the main reason. Temperatures over 100°F cause the steel in torsion springs to expand and contract daily, and after enough cycles, the metal fatigues and the spring snaps, sometimes with a clean break at the coil. Coastal LA doesn’t get the same sustained thermal load, so springs there last longer on paper. In Montclair, we recommend high-cycle springs rated at 25,000 cycles on any new install because standard 10,000-cycle springs fail in 4-5 years under this climate. For a heavy oversized door on a detached workshop, we recommend a LiftMaster or Chamberlain jackshaft opener mounted on the wall rather than a ceiling-mount trolley, because it handles the extra weight without the rail flex you get on ceiling-mounted units. Pair it with high-cycle torsion springs rated for at least 25,000 cycles, and use reinforced track brackets anchored to solid framing, not drywall. The door itself should be steel with an insulation R-value of at least 12 if you’re heating the space. Santa Ana winds put lateral pressure on sectional doors, and if the track brackets are corroded or undersized for the door’s weight, the panels can lift off the track during a strong gust. On older Montclair homes where the original 1960s brackets are still in place, installing a heavier modern door without replacing the brackets is asking for a failure in the first windy season. We check every bracket during installation and torque or replace as needed. It’s part of the job, not an upsell.
